Trojans fall twice, Thunder and Wolfpack split weekend games

Nov 17, 2025 | 10:51 AM

The Tisdale Trojans dropped a couple of games in Swift Current on the weekend.

They fell 5-4 on Saturday, with goals from Ramy Borowsky, Tristan Hanson, and a couple from Carter Hudyma.

Wyatt Fleischhacker made 37 stops for the Trojans, who lost 4-2 on Sunday.

Jacob Tait scored both Tisdale goals, and Jackson Dunn stopped 32 shots.

Tisdale is now 6-9-1, and they host Yorkton on Wednesday.

A split for the Carrot River Outback Thunder in PJHL action this weekend.

They dumped the Prince Albert Timberjacks 7-1 on Friday.

Dawson Malinowski scored twice, while Gavin Bodnarchuk, Rhett Lubda, Nolan Holmen, Kieran Hardie, and Chase Taylor had singles.

Hunter Nakonechny stopped 25 shots in the win.

The Saskatoon Westleys downed Carrot River 6-1 the following day.

Cash Aasen scored the lone Thunder goal and Dominic Smith made 39 saves for Carrot River.

The Northeast Wolfpack were 1-1 on the weekend as well.

They started with a 5-2 victory over the Martensville Marauders on Saturday.

Hayle Dennis scored twice for the Wolfpack, with Beau Hayworth, Colt Hrebeniuk, and Nixon Coleman also scoring.

John Gall was on fire in net, making 56 saves.

The Saskatoon Riverkings beat the Wolfpack 10-2 on Sunday.

Chase Skopliak and Taylor Coleman scored for the Wolfpack, and Kane Huston stopped 46 shots.
